Darryl Bowler

About Darryl Bowler

Darryl Bowler, Senior Systems Architect, Services, CollabNet

Ten Best Practices for Continuous Integration

Continuous Integration is a practice, not a tool.  Implementing a successful CI practice within an organization requires discipline, particularly when your development environment contains a significant amount of complexity.  Much of what we talk about in our CI series is establishing discipline and best practices that become engrained in our processes.  Best practices are methods or techniques that consistently bring superior results.  Best practices evolve over time as new technology and techniques are introduced or improvements discovered. Here are 10 best practices for continuous integration that will be especially helpful for those new to CI or wanting to improve their …

Read More »